Academic Biography
Until August 2015 Ian was a Lecturer in Information and Communication Technology (ICT) at the University of York and studied computing, multimedia software design and music technology. Ian's research interests are in the usability of software, applied music technology and virtual learning environments and how these technologies can be used in an education setting.

Software & Research Projects
- 2011 /2015: Audio recording to simulate the experience of schizophrenia
- 2008 / 2010: Lecture replacement project to video record lectures for replacement with Adobe Captivate software.
- 2007 / 2008: “Needle Injection Phobia Project (NIPP) Interactive Skills Training DVD Model”A project to produce visual demonstrations of c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T) for the treatment of blood injury/needle phobia.
- 2005 / 2006: A collaborative evaluation project between the University of Hull and the University of York to assess the impact of the NEYNL WDC eLearning strategy on the work-based practice of health professionals and NHS Trusts in the North and East Yorkshire and North Lincolnshire SHA region.
- 2005: E-tutoring Course, a University of York funded staff course as an introduction to e-moderating and facilitating online learning communities. A short 3-week non-accredited course that introduces teaching staff to the main issues surrounding e-learning and online tutoring
- 2004 / 2005: Evaluation of The Students On-Line in Nursing Integrated Curricula project (SONIC).
- 2003 / 2004: Shock Skills, a computer software program on clinical shock. TIDC funded.http://www.york.ac.uk/admin/aso/TIDC/welcome.htm#Directory
- 2002 / 2003: CLaSS Software, a computer and information literacy package for nursing students - class software.
